What affects the price

The final bill for a full home remodel depends on several moving parts. The biggest factors are the square footage of the space and the quality of the materials you select, such as custom cabinetry or high-end flooring. Structural changes—like moving walls, plumbing, or electrical systems—also shift the budget significantly compared to simple cosmetic updates. What is the difference between renovating and remodeling?

Renovating often means restoring something to good condition, like updating finishes or replacing old fixtures in your Santa Clarita home. Remodeling implies a more significant change, such as altering the layout of a room, changing its purpose, or adding square footage. Both aim to improve your living space.

Is it cheaper to buy a house or remodel?

This is a common question for Santa Clarita residents. Often, remodeling an existing home can be cheaper than buying a new one, especially if you find a property with good bones in a desirable area but outdated interiors. However, significant remodels can sometimes approach the cost of a new purchase, so getting estimates is crucial.
